Exploring the Literary Landscape: The Legacy of Sotiris Alexandropoulos

Sotiris Alexandropoulos is a prominent figure in the realm of contemporary Greek literature and academia. Renowned for his multifaceted contributions to poetry, prose, and critical discourse, Alexandropoulos has left an indelible mark on the cultural landscape of Greece and beyond.

Sotiris Alexandropoulos

Born in Athens, Greece, in 1975, Alexandropoulos exhibited an early passion for literature and language. He pursued his academic endeavors at the University of Athens, where he attained a degree in Modern Greek Literature. Subsequently, he furthered his studies abroad, immersing himself in comparative literature and literary theory.

Alexandropoulos's literary oeuvre is characterized by its poetic depth, linguistic innovation, and thematic richness. His poetry collections, spanning themes of identity, memory, and existential introspection, have garnered widespread acclaim. Through his lyrical exploration of the human condition, Alexandropoulos invites readers into a nuanced dialogue with the complexities of contemporary life.

Beyond his creative output, Alexandropoulos is recognized for his scholarly pursuits. As a professor of literature at the University of Thessaloniki, he has nurtured the intellectual development of countless students, imparting his profound insights into literary analysis and interpretation. His academic publications, ranging from critical essays to monographs, have contributed significantly to the ongoing discourse surrounding Greek literature and its intersection with global literary traditions.

In addition to his literary and academic endeavors, Alexandropoulos is an active participant in cultural initiatives aimed at fostering dialogue and exchange within the literary community. He has organized literary festivals, moderated panel discussions, and collaborated with fellow writers and artists to promote the appreciation of literature as a vital aspect of human experience.

Alexandropoulos's impact extends beyond the confines of academia and literature, as he remains a vocal advocate for social and political engagement. Through his public appearances, interviews, and writings, he addresses pressing issues facing contemporary society, challenging readers to confront entrenched norms and envision alternative futures.

As both a creator and a scholar, Sotiris Alexandropoulos occupies a unique position within the cultural milieu, bridging the realms of artistic expression and intellectual inquiry. His work continues to resonate with audiences worldwide, inviting them to explore the intricate tapestry of human existence through the prism of language and literature.
